Markdown,这是一种轻量级的标记语言,它的设计哲学是易学易用,能够让作者快速地完成文本内容的排版。它不需要复杂的代码,只需要简单的符号就可以实现对文本的格式化。无论是写作、笔记整理还是制作文档,Markdown都是一个非常实用的工具。
1. 基础语法
1.1 标题
在Markdown中,标题可以通过在文本前加上不同的“#”来设置。一个“#”代表一级标题,两个“##”代表二级标题,以此类推。
# 这是一级标题
## 这是二级标题
1.2 段落和换行
直接将文本输入到文档中,Markdown会自动将其视为普通段落。如果想要进行换行,只需在行尾按下“Shift+Enter”。
1.3 强调
使用星号“*”或下划线“_”可以创建斜体或粗体。
- 斜体:使用单个星号或下划线包裹文本,如
*这是斜体*或_这是斜体_。 - 粗体:使用两个星号或下划线包裹文本,如
**这是粗体**或__这是粗体__。
1.4 列表
Markdown支持有序和无序列表。
- 有序列表:使用数字和句点创建,如
1. 第一项、2. 第二项。 - 无序列表:使用星号、加号或减号创建,如
- 第一项、+ 第二项。
1.5 链接和图片
- 链接:使用方括号包裹文本,圆括号包裹链接地址,如
[Markdown](https://markdown.com)。 - 图片:与链接类似,使用感叹号、方括号和圆括号,如
。
2. 高级用法
2.1 引用
使用大于号“>”创建引用,可以嵌套使用。
> 这是引用
> > 这是嵌套引用
2.2 表格
| 表头1 | 表头2 | 表头3 |
| --- | --- | --- |
| 内容1 | 内容2 | 内容3 |
| 内容4 | 内容5 | 内容6 |
2.3 代码块
使用三个反引号包裹代码块,并可选地指定编程语言。
```python
def hello_world():
print("Hello, World!")
## 3. 实例详解
让我们通过一个简单的示例来展示Markdown的用法。
```markdown
# Markdown实例详解
## 一级标题
## 二级标题
这是一个普通段落。
**这是粗体文本**
*这是斜体文本*
这是一个无序列表:
- 第一项
- 第二项
- 第三项
这是一个有序列表:
1. 第一项
2. 第二项
3. 第三项
[这是一个链接](https://markdown.com)

> 这是一个引用
| 表头1 | 表头2 | 表头3 |
| --- | --- | --- |
| 内容1 | 内容2 | 内容3 |
| 内容4 | 内容5 | 内容6 |
```python
def hello_world():
print("Hello, World!")
通过以上示例,我们可以看到Markdown的强大之处,它能够帮助我们轻松地创建格式化良好的文档。
4. 总结
Markdown是一种非常实用的文本编辑工具,它可以帮助我们提高写作效率。通过本文的介绍,相信你已经对Markdown有了基本的了解。在实际应用中,多加练习和摸索,你会更快地掌握Markdown的编辑技巧。
